Devflow CMF vs WordPress: WordPress Alternative

Devflow and WordPress share some similarities: both are self-hosted, PHP-based, and highly customizable. Devflow even leverages shared code with WordPress, though it's not a fork. This shared codebase, particularly in the API, event system, and helper functions, makes it easier for developers familiar with WordPress to transition to Devflow.

However, significant differences set Devflow apart as a compelling WordPress alternative.

Framework for Bespoke Website Creation

Devflow functions as a content management framework, empowering developers to build unique websites and applications with unparalleled autonomy and flexibility. Think of it as a robust content repository upon which you construct a tailored structure.

Unlike WordPress's reliance on the "Post" content type, Devflow lets you define custom content types to precisely match your project's needs. A blog isn't mandatory; you build the content model your site requires. Even in blog development, content types can serve as categories. The admin dashboard is clean and customizable, devoid of widgets and unnecessary clutter; developers can leverage built-in hooks to create a client-specific dashboard.

Themes and plugins extend functionality and presentation. Alternatively, the REST API allows integration with various frontend frameworks for customized presentation layers.

DDD, CQRS, and Event Sourcing Advantages

Devflow's core strength lies in its foundation on the CodefyPHP framework, ideal for domain-driven design (DDD) projects employing Command Query Responsibility Segregation (CQRS) and Event Sourcing. While DDD's complexity might initially seem daunting, the payoff is substantial.

  • Built-in Revisions: Every change generates an event stored for later retrieval. A custom UI can be built to restore content to previous versions.

  • Scalability for Complex Projects: Devflow handles growing project complexity and mission-critical applications with ease. You can create solutions directly aligned with business operations.

  • Flexibility and Long-Term Viability: Modular design ensures easy upgrades, modifications, and modernization, extending the website or application's lifespan.

Page Builder Integration

While Devflow doesn't include a built-in page builder, it seamlessly integrates with PHPagebuilder, a framework-agnostic drag-and-drop solution that's also highly customizable.

Designed for PHP Developers

Unlike WordPress, Devflow is explicitly built for PHP developers. It's not a CMS to be hacked; it's a framework to build the exact CMS you envision.

WordPress dominates the CMS market, powering a significant portion of the web. Its legacy is undeniable. But if you prioritize freedom, flexibility, and developer control, Devflow offers a compelling alternative. Devflow CMF represents the freedom to customize, create bespoke CMS solutions, and leverage any frontend framework you prefer.

PHP Variable Scope Explained PHP Variable Scope Explained Jul 17, 2025 am 04:16 AM

Common problems and solutions for PHP variable scope include: 1. The global variable cannot be accessed within the function, and it needs to be passed in using the global keyword or parameter; 2. The static variable is declared with static, and it is only initialized once and the value is maintained between multiple calls; 3. Hyperglobal variables such as $_GET and $_POST can be used directly in any scope, but you need to pay attention to safe filtering; 4. Anonymous functions need to introduce parent scope variables through the use keyword, and when modifying external variables, you need to pass a reference. Mastering these rules can help avoid errors and improve code stability.

How to handle File Uploads securely in PHP? How to handle File Uploads securely in PHP? Jul 08, 2025 am 02:37 AM

To safely handle PHP file uploads, you need to verify the source and type, control the file name and path, set server restrictions, and process media files twice. 1. Verify the upload source to prevent CSRF through token and detect the real MIME type through finfo_file using whitelist control; 2. Rename the file to a random string and determine the extension to store it in a non-Web directory according to the detection type; 3. PHP configuration limits the upload size and temporary directory Nginx/Apache prohibits access to the upload directory; 4. The GD library resaves the pictures to clear potential malicious data.

How to access a character in a string by index in PHP How to access a character in a string by index in PHP Jul 12, 2025 am 03:15 AM

In PHP, you can use square brackets or curly braces to obtain string specific index characters, but square brackets are recommended; the index starts from 0, and the access outside the range returns a null value and cannot be assigned a value; mb_substr is required to handle multi-byte characters. For example: $str="hello";echo$str[0]; output h; and Chinese characters such as mb_substr($str,1,1) need to obtain the correct result; in actual applications, the length of the string should be checked before looping, dynamic strings need to be verified for validity, and multilingual projects recommend using multi-byte security functions uniformly.
